PNC Bank Adopts Ripple's xCurrent for Real-Time Cross-Border Payments

ยท

In a significant move for blockchain adoption in traditional finance, PNC Bank, the ninth-largest bank in the United States by assets, has integrated Ripple's xCurrent solution. This integration enables PNC to offer real-time cross-border payment services to its commercial clients, marking a notable step forward in modernizing international transactions.

By joining RippleNet, PNC Bank gains access to a global network of over 100 financial institutions already using Ripple's enterprise blockchain technology. This collaboration allows PNC to process inbound international payments instantly, providing greater efficiency and transparency for its customers.

What Is RippleNet and How Does It Work?

RippleNet is Ripple's decentralized global network designed to facilitate fast, secure, and low-cost international payments. It connects banks, payment providers, and other financial institutions through a standardized infrastructure that simplifies cross-border transactions.

The network operates using Ripple's distributed ledger technology, which enables participants to send and receive payments with end-to-end tracking and real-time confirmation. This eliminates many of the traditional pain points associated with international transfers, such as delayed settlements and lack of transparency.

Understanding xCurrent: Ripple's Enterprise Solution

xCurrent is Ripple's enterprise software solution tailored for financial institutions. It enables banks to settle cross-border payments instantly while providing complete visibility into the transaction process. Unlike some other Ripple products, xCurrent does not utilize XRP, making it particularly appealing to traditional banks that may be hesitant to engage directly with digital assets.

The Strategic Importance for PNC Bank

With over 8 million customers across 19 states, PNC Bank serves a diverse client base that includes retail consumers, small businesses, and large corporations. The integration with RippleNet particularly benefits their commercial banking segment, where timely international payments can significantly impact business operations.

The implementation follows a successful pilot phase and proof-of-concept testing. According to Ripple executives, PNC will initially use xCurrent for inbound transactions, with plans to potentially expand to outbound payments as the partnership develops.

This move positions PNC as an innovator among traditional U.S. banks, offering services that compete with fintech companies while maintaining the security and reliability expected from an established financial institution.

xCurrent vs. xRapid: Understanding the Difference

While xCurrent focuses on instant settlement using traditional currencies, xRapid utilizes XRP as a bridge currency to facilitate cross-border payments. This fundamental difference makes xCurrent more immediately palatable to banks cautious about cryptocurrency adoption.

Ripple's strategy appears to be introducing banks to their technology through xCurrent before gradually introducing them to xRapid and XRP. This stepped approach allows financial institutions to become comfortable with blockchain technology without immediately confronting the regulatory and operational considerations of digital assets.

Industry experts suggest that xRapid offers additional advantages for payments involving currencies with limited liquidity or those in emerging markets, where XRP can serve as an efficient bridge between different financial systems.

Frequently Asked Questions

What benefits does Ripple's xCurrent provide to banks?
xCurrent enables banks to process cross-border payments instantly with end-to-end tracking capabilities. This reduces settlement times from days to seconds, improves transparency for customers, and lowers operational costs associated with international transfers.

Does xCurrent require banks to use XRP?
No, xCurrent operates without utilizing XRP, making it suitable for banks that prefer to avoid cryptocurrency exposure. It settles transactions directly in traditional currencies between participating institutions.

How does RippleNet differ from traditional payment networks?
RippleNet uses distributed ledger technology to create a decentralized network of financial institutions that can transact directly with each other. This eliminates multiple intermediaries, reduces costs, and accelerates settlement times compared to traditional correspondent banking systems.

What types of transactions is xCurrent best suited for?
xCurrent is particularly effective for commercial cross-border payments where speed, transparency, and cost efficiency are important. It benefits businesses that regularly receive international payments and need better cash flow management.

Are there geographical limitations to using RippleNet?
RippleNet continues to expand globally, but availability depends on having participating financial institutions in both the sending and receiving countries. The network's coverage grows as more banks join the ecosystem.

How secure is Ripple's blockchain technology for banking transactions?
Ripple employs enterprise-grade security protocols including cryptographic encryption, secure APIs, and compliance with financial industry security standards. Transactions on the network are validated through consensus among participants rather than mining.
